Inflatable Dog Pool Float, 55 x 38” Dog Swimming Raft Floating Mat for Small Medium and Large Dogs - Up to 90lbs
Trustpilot
Reema J.
1 month ago
Pooja R.
1 week ago
Duties & taxes incl.
30 daysfor PRO membership users
15 dayswithout membership
Sneha T.
Abdullah B.
3 weeks ago